TRUE STORY
I was volunteering in South Central, teaching tennis to kids...
One morning, I have my list of kids in my hand, doing roll call - and I'm always entertained by the variety of names in this neighborhood...but one makes me stop short. I ask the child's mother how she pronounces her daughter's name. She looks at me like I'm absolutely crazy and says, "YOUR-EEN." Like, how else would I pronounce it?
